Two dead in parasailing accident at Ocean Isle Beach


print friendly

The Coast Guard says it is investigating a parasailing accident that killed two women near the Ocean Isle Beach Pier in North Carolina.

The Coast Guard says an initial report indicates that the rope on the women's parasail separated from the boat it was connected to Friday afternoon.

Coast Guard investigators are interviewing witnesses and the master and crew of the boat, Tied High. Drug and alcohol tests have been conducted on the crew.

The women were identified as Lorrie Schoup and Cynthia Woodcock, Coast Guard officials said. The women's ages and hometowns have not been released.
